030 Final CVD6s. Having already bought forty Daimler CVD6 double-deck buses between 1947 and 1951 a final batch of ten entered service in 1953. With Weymann bodies built to seat 56 passengers four of them survived until 1975 (numbers 70, 74, 78 and 79) becoming the last exposed-radiator Daimlers working in a Scottish fleet. Pictured is Daimler number 70 CTS629 at Shore Terrace beneath the magnificent Corporation Transport Department clock.
